Summary

Metal-detecting at this location in 2015 recovered a Late Bronze Age sword fragment; a Roman pin and a medieval pottery sherd.

May-June 2015. Metal-detecting. [1].
Late Bronze Age 'Saint Nazaire'-type sword blade fragment (S1).
Roman pin.
1 medieval pottery sherd.
